Mestia, Georgia

Where Eastern Europe meets Western Asia. Georgia is in the heart of the Caucasus Mountain range. With 3 peaks tipping the 5000m scale this is a range to respect. The trip is based in the remote Svaneti region, in the old historic village of Mestia. In 2016 the Georgian government invested in 2 new ski resorts nearby to help promote tourism for the local economy. Hatsvali which is lower, tree lined and good for bad weather days and the freeride oriented Tetnuldi. Incredible terrain accessed straight from the lifts and due to the high altitude you know the snow quality is going to be exceptional. The ever friendly stray dogs generally  outnumber the free riders. Due to its remote location, and challenging mountain roads, most skiers and snowboarders opt for the easier to access Gudauri in the east than heading to Mestia in the west. This trip is for those keen for an adventure, an immersive cultural experience, incredible cuisine and the quietist resort I’ve every experienced. There are also options for touring and overnight homestays in the Unesco world heritage site and village of Ushguli.

Logistics

It is possible to fly 3 airports in Georgia. The main is in the capital of Tbilisi but you also have options of Kutasia or Batumi. The transfer to Mestia is long, around 8hrs from Tbilisi and 5hrs from the others. Often people like to arrive 2 days earlier into the Georgian capital, Tblisi and spend a day and a night there before taking the train across to the west and then a shorter transfer up to Mestia. This will allow for the full Georgian cultural experience. It is up to you how you travel but we will arrange and advise on transfer. During our stay we have private 7 seater 4×4 vehicles and the same drivers will transport us all week to wherever we choose to ride.
